首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    c++类的构造函数不显式声明会自动生成吗

    本篇文章讲解c++11中,类的构造函数种类,以及不显式声明的情况下是否会自动生成。 1....构造函数默认生成规则 2.1 没有显式声明任何构造函数 编译器会自动生成默认的无参构造函数,这一点我们是可以肯定的,那另外几种构造函数也会默认生成吗,这个就不太确定了。...也就是说当只声明拷贝构造函数的时候,其他构造包括普通构造都不会自动生成,而当声明了普通构造和拷贝构造时,移动构造会自动生成。 3....构造函数自动生成总结 总结一下,构造函数自动生成的规则: 没有显式声明任何构造函数时,会自动生成普通构造函数、拷贝构造函数、赋值构造函数、移动构造函数、移动赋值构造函数五种; 对于带普通参数的构造函数,...任何情况下都不会自动生成; 显式声明普通构造函数时,会自动生成拷贝构造函数、赋值构造函数、移动构造函数、移动赋值构造函数四种; 只显式声明拷贝构造函数时,普通构造函数都不会自动生成,没有办法生成对象;

    1.2K20

    ROAD数据集 | 基于道路事件,会让自动驾驶像人那样感知环境吗?

    作者 | 洁萍 编辑 | 青暮 自动驾驶汽车如何像人那样感知环境并做出决策? 像人一样感知环境并做出决策,这是人们对自动驾驶汽车的最终想象。...为了了解道路上发生的情况,如今的自动驾驶车辆通常配备了一系列不同的传感器(如激光测距仪、雷达、摄像头、GPS )来收集数据,不过ROAD主要考虑的是基于视觉的自动驾驶车辆的行驶环境。...标注都是从自动驾驶车辆的角度完成的,最终目标是为了让自动驾驶车辆利用此信息做出适当的决策。 元数据旨在包含所有需要全面描述了道路场景的信息,下图给出了该概念的说明。...,一辆绿色汽车在自动驾驶车辆前面。...(b)从6号车道向左转进入4号车道的自动驾驶车辆:因为车流与自动驾驶车辆方向相同,4号车道将成为驶出车道。

    38710

    2024年了,你知道硬断言和软断言在自动化测试中的作用和区别吗?

    你知道硬断言和软断言在自动化测试中的作用吗? 一、什么是断言? 断言的主要目的是验证应用程序在插入的检查点处以及整体上是否正常工作。...“我的期望与实际结果相符吗?告诉我是真是假。 当执行断言时,它会评估一个条件(通常是实际值和期望值之间的比较)。如果条件为真,则测试继续运行。如果条件为假,则断言将抛出错误,将测试标记为失败。...这是一种软断言的方式,使得你可以在测试失败后继续执行其他断言,而不是立即停止。...效率: 有时修复第一个发现的bug可能会引入其他问题。如果你使用硬断言,只有在修复第一个问题并重新运行测试后才能发现这些问题。...在使用`pytest.assume()`时,如果出现断言失败的情况,会如何继续执行其他断言? 当使用 pytest.assume() 函数时,该函数会捕获断言错误并将其记录下来,而不会立即抛出异常。

    35510

    RoboMaster S1 高清大图+改装建议

    当然了,事情都是决定的,这样的设计首先会加重车体的设计难度,前驱部分的机械结构也会相应的变复杂。使用中发现,这个部分是自动归位的,也就是说使用了类似于柔性弹簧的东西。...希望未来的战车会使用减震设计,会扩宽机器的运动场景。 其中上面的部分是云台组件,射击单元,发声单元,中控单元,摄像头单元。我最喜欢就是这个摄像头了,做的不要太美。...射击单元是悬空滑腔式设计(我编的),里面加了一根相对较软的弹簧,这样的做法是来降低水弹连续发射时积累的作用力,Ft=Mv(冲量公式),我们用简单的冲量公式就可以算出这个力不小,当然了射击角度是可以调整的...话说可以玩的稳妥些吗? 一个这样强大的机器,没有一个强悍的动力核心肯定不美妙。所以大疆为其设计了一款智能电池?...(可以用多久)充电快吗?两个问题,我想你看了参数会有自己的答案,想玩的嗨可以再准备一块电池。

    1.9K60

    打造稳定、快速、统一、无打扰的windows桌面使用环境

    扩展商店,并增加了非常多实用的功能,如:整体界面定制、地址栏二维码、标签打开方式调节、标签滚轮切换、标签双击关闭、迅雷加速模块、图片快速保存、鼠标手势、内核切换、挖矿防护、视频工具栏、平滑滚动、高内存占用自动释放...不都是office吗?...另外影音图像处理从业者千万不要用他,调整色温必然会带来颜色失准,切记。 迅雷极速 很多人说迅雷已经死了,我是坚决不这么认为的,迅雷依然是国内,甚至全世界最快的下载工具,弹广告?不能下载敏感资源?...200M带宽跑24M/s你还满意吗?...软媒工具箱 U盘启动 软媒时间 虚拟光驱 软媒,win7时代,他曾经辉煌过,她告诉了我们,优秀的软件不需要庞大的体积,不需要广告。

    1.5K20

    Dubbo 面试题

    软负载均衡及容错机制,可在内网替代F5等硬件负载均衡器,降低成本,减少单点。...服务自动注册与发现,不再需要写死服务提供方地址,注册中心基于接口名查询服务提供者的IP地址,并且能够平滑添加或删除服务提供者。 1、默认使用的是什么通信框架,还有别的选择吗?...答:读操作建议使用 Failover 失败自动切换,默认重试两次其他服务器。写操作建议使用 Failfast 快速失败,发一次调用失败就立即报错。 13、在使用过程中都遇到了些什么问题?如何解决的?...一致性 Hash 策略,使相同参数请求总是发到同一提供者,一台机器宕机,可以基于虚拟节点,分摊至其他提供者,避免引起提供者的剧烈变动; 18、服务调用超时问题怎么解决 dubbo在调用服务不成功时,默认是会重试两次的...当然Dubbo的重试机制其实是非常好的QOS保证,它的路由机制,是会帮你把超时的请求路由到其他机器上,而不是本机尝试,所以 dubbo的重试机器也能一定程度的保证服务的质量。

    73520

    这些你都会吗?

    软负载均衡及容错机制,可在内网替代F5等硬件负载均衡器,降低成本,减少单点。...服务自动注册与发现,不再需要写死服务提供方地址,注册中心基于接口名查询服务提供者的IP地址,并且能够平滑添加或删除服务提供者。 1、默认使用的是什么通信框架,还有别的选择吗?...答:读操作建议使用 Failover 失败自动切换,默认重试两次其他服务器。写操作建议使用 Failfast 快速失败,发一次调用失败就立即报错。 13、在使用过程中都遇到了些什么问题?如何解决的?...一致性 Hash 策略,使相同参数请求总是发到同一提供者,一台机器宕机,可以基于虚拟节点,分摊至其他提供者,避免引起提供者的剧烈变动; 18、服务调用超时问题怎么解决 dubbo在调用服务不成功时,默认是会重试两次的...当然Dubbo的重试机制其实是非常好的QOS保证,它的路由机制,是会帮你把超时的请求路由到其他机器上,而不是本机尝试,所以 dubbo的重试机器也能一定程度的保证服务的质量。

    51000

    Dubbo 面试18问,你能接得住吗?

    软负载均衡及容错机制,可在内网替代F5等硬件负载均衡器,降低成本,减少单点。...服务自动注册与发现,不再需要写死服务提供方地址,注册中心基于接口名查询服务提供者的IP地址,并且能够平滑添加或删除服务提供者。 1、默认使用的是什么通信框架,还有别的选择吗?...答:读操作建议使用 Failover 失败自动切换,默认重试两次其他服务器。写操作建议使用 Failfast 快速失败,发一次调用失败就立即报错。 13、在使用过程中都遇到了些什么问题?如何解决的?...服务调用超时问题怎么解决 dubbo在调用服务不成功时,默认是会重试两次的。...QOS保证,它的路由机制,是会帮你把超时的请求路由到其他机器上,而不是本机尝试,所以 dubbo的重试机器也能一定程度的保证服务的质量。

    77810

    18个Dubbo面试题

    软负载均衡及容错机制,可在内网替代F5等硬件负载均衡器,降低成本,减少单点。...服务自动注册与发现,不再需要写死服务提供方地址,注册中心基于接口名查询服务提供者的IP地址,并且能够平滑添加或删除服务提供者。 1、默认使用的是什么通信框架,还有别的选择吗?...答:读操作建议使用 Failover 失败自动切换,默认重试两次其他服务器。写操作建议使用 Failfast 快速失败,发一次调用失败就立即报错。 13、在使用过程中都遇到了些什么问题?如何解决的?...一致性 Hash 策略,使相同参数请求总是发到同一提供者,一台机器宕机,可以基于虚拟节点,分摊至其他提供者,避免引起提供者的剧烈变动; 18、服务调用超时问题怎么解决 dubbo在调用服务不成功时,默认是会重试两次的...业务处理代码必须放在服务端,客户端只做参数验证和服务调用,不涉及业务流程处理 全局配置实例 当然Dubbo的重试机制其实是非常好的QOS保证,它的路由机制,是会帮你把超时的请求路由到其他机器上,而不是本机尝试

    41220

    移动端UI自动化过程中的难点及应对策略

    有人可能会问干嘛不直接用Release包,主要是因为Release包一般会存在证书信任问题导致无法使用Mock Server。...,重试可以是步骤级别的比如显示等待,也可以是页面级别的,甚至可以是业务流程级别的。...问题7:非预期的弹出对话框 这里包括系统弹框和应用内业务弹框,针对系统弹框,我们可以通过无障碍服务来实现智能点击处理,对于应用内业务弹框,如果是可以通过接口控制的,我们可以Mock掉这个接口,否则我们可以通过...问题4:网络环境不稳定 有时候在办公网环境下做自动化会遇到AP连接数太多导致自动化设备的网络出现抖动,这时我们可以通过增加独立AP的方式来解决。...今天就先分享到这里,后续会针对文中的一些具体问题做详细方案的讲解,欢迎有兴趣的同学跟我讨论。

    92920

    关于dubbo,这里有你不得不看的18个BAT面试题

    软负载均衡及容错机制,可在内网替代F5等硬件负载均衡器,降低成本,减少单点。...服务自动注册与发现,不再需要写死服务提供方地址,注册中心基于接口名查询服务提供者的IP地址,并且能够平滑添加或删除服务提供者。 1、默认使用的是什么通信框架,还有别的选择吗?...答:读操作建议使用 Failover 失败自动切换,默认重试两次其他服务器。写操作建议使用 Failfast 快速失败,发一次调用失败就立即报错。 13、在使用过程中都遇到了些什么问题?如何解决的?...一致性 Hash 策略,使相同参数请求总是发到同一提供者,一台机器宕机,可以基于虚拟节点,分摊至其他提供者,避免引起提供者的剧烈变动; 18、服务调用超时问题怎么解决 dubbo在调用服务不成功时,默认是会重试两次的...业务处理代码必须放在服务端,客户端只做参数验证和服务调用,不涉及业务流程处理 全局配置实例 当然Dubbo的重试机制其实是非常好的QOS保证,它的路由机制,是会帮你把超时的请求路由到其他机器上,而不是本机尝试

    52340

    dubbo 面试18问

    软负载均衡及容错机制,可在内网替代F5等硬件负载均衡器,降低成本,减少单点。...服务自动注册与发现,不再需要写死服务提供方地址,注册中心基于接口名查询服务提供者的IP地址,并且能够平滑添加或删除服务提供者。 1、默认使用的是什么通信框架,还有别的选择吗?...答:读操作建议使用 Failover 失败自动切换,默认重试两次其他服务器。写操作建议使用 Failfast 快速失败,发一次调用失败就立即报错。 13、在使用过程中都遇到了些什么问题?...服务调用超时问题怎么解决 dubbo在调用服务不成功时,默认是会重试两次的。...QOS保证,它的路由机制,是会帮你把超时的请求路由到其他机器上,而不是本机尝试,所以 dubbo的重试机器也能一定程度的保证服务的质量。

    55810

    Selenium(思维导图)

    Selenium(思维导图) 目录 1、浏览器基本操作 2、元素查找方法 3、鼠标和键盘事件 4、窗口/iframe切换 5、select下拉框 6、弹框 7、JS处理(滚动条等) 8、框架 9、selenium...find_element_by_xpath() 3、鼠标和键盘事件 简单操作 键盘操作 鼠标悬停事件 4、窗口/iframe切换 5、select下拉框 分两步定位 直接定位 Select模块定位 6、弹框...alert弹框 处理自定义弹框消失 7、JS处理(滚动条等) 滚动到底部 滚动到顶部 聚焦元素 播放视频 8、框架 数据驱动ddt 窗口截图(元素截图) 用例失败重试机制...报告解析 自动化测试模型 PageObject和PageFactory设计模式 9、selenium常见异常 10、断言 原生 hamcrest断言库 11、cookie处理 12、

    90721

    这些题你都遇到过吗?

    自动发现:基于注册中心目录服务,使服务消费方能动态的查找服务提供方,使地址透明,使服务提供方可以平滑增加或减少机器。...软负载均衡及容错机制,可在内网替代F5等硬件负载均衡器,降低成本,减少单点。...答:读操作建议使用 Failover 失败自动切换,默认重试两次其他服务器。写操作建议使用 Failfast 快速失败,发一次调用失败就立即报错。 15、在使用过程中都遇到了些什么问题?...一致性 Hash 策略,使相同参数请求总是发到同一提供者,一台机器宕机,可以基于虚拟节点,分摊至其他提供者,避免引起提供者的剧烈变动; 20、服务调用超时问题怎么解决 dubbo在调用服务不成功时,默认是会重试两次的...QOS保证,它的路由机制,是会帮你把超时的请求路由到其他机器上,而不是本机尝试,所以 dubbo的重试机器也能一定程度的保证服务的质量。

    94070
    领券